Horse and Burro Management at Sheldon National Wildlife Refuge
U.S. Fish & Wildlife Service Horse and Burro Management at Sheldon National Wildlife Refuge Environmental Assessment Before Horse Gather, August 2004 September 2002 After Horse Gather, August 2005 Front Cover: The left two photographs were taken one year apart at the same site, Big Spring Creek on Sheldon National Wildlife Refuge. The first photograph was taken in August 2004 at the time of a large horse gather on Big Spring Butte which resulted in the removal of 293 horses. These horses were placed in homes through adoption. The photograph shows the extensive damage to vegetation along the ripar- ian area caused by horses. The second photo was taken one-year later (August 2005) at the same posi- tion and angle, and shows the response of vegetation from reduced grazing pressure of horses. Woody vegetation and other responses of the ecosystem will take many years for restoration from the damage. An additional photograph on the right of the page was taken in September 2002 at Big Spring Creek. The tall vegetation was protected from grazing by the cage on the left side of the photograph. Stubble height of vegetation outside the cage was 4 cm, and 35 cm inside the cage (nearly 10 times the height). The intensity of horse grazing pressure was high until the gather in late 2004. Additional photo com- parisons are available from other riparian sites. Photo credit: FWS, David N. Purebred Dog Breeds into the Twenty-First Century: Achieving Genetic Health for Our Dogs BY JEFFREY BRAGG WHAT IS A CANINE BREED? What is a breed? To put the question more precisely, what are the necessary conditions that enable us to say with conviction, "this group of animals constitutes a distinct breed?" In the cynological world, three separate approaches combine to constitute canine breeds. Dogs are distinguished first by ancestry , all of the individuals descending from a particular founder group (and only from that group) being designated as a breed. Next they are distinguished by purpose or utility, some breeds existing for the purpose of hunting particular kinds of game,others for the performance of particular tasks in cooperation with their human masters, while yet others owe their existence simply to humankind's desire for animal companionship. Finally dogs are distinguished by typology , breed standards (whether written or unwritten) being used to describe and to recognize dogs of specific size, physical build, general appearance, shape of head, style of ears and tail, etc., which are said to be of the same breed owing to their similarity in the foregoing respects. The preceding statements are both obvious and known to all breeders and fanciers of the canine species. Nevertheless a correct and full understanding of these simple truisms is vital to the proper functioning of the entire canine fancy and to the health and well being of the animals which are the object of that fancy. It is my purpose in this brief to elucidate the interrelationship of the above three approaches, to demonstrate how distortions and misunderstandings of that interrelationship now threaten the health of all of our dogs and the very existence of the various canine breeds, and to propose reforms which will restore both balanced breed identity and genetic health to CKC breeds. -

List of horse breeds 1 List of horse breeds This page is a list of horse and pony breeds, and also includes terms used to describe types of horse that are not breeds but are commonly mistaken for breeds. While there is no scientifically accepted definition of the term "breed,"[1] a breed is defined generally as having distinct true-breeding characteristics over a number of generations; its members may be called "purebred". In most cases, bloodlines of horse breeds are recorded with a breed registry. However, in horses, the concept is somewhat flexible, as open stud books are created for developing horse breeds that are not yet fully true-breeding. Registries also are considered the authority as to whether a given breed is listed as Light or saddle horse breeds a "horse" or a "pony". There are also a number of "color breed", sport horse, and gaited horse registries for horses with various phenotypes or other traits, which admit any animal fitting a given set of physical characteristics, even if there is little or no evidence of the trait being a true-breeding characteristic. Other recording entities or specialty organizations may recognize horses from multiple breeds, thus, for the purposes of this article, such animals are classified as a "type" rather than a "breed". FACTSHEET: OWNERS MULES AND HINNIES Mules and hinnies are similar. They are both a cross between a horse and a donkey, with unique characteristics that make them special. Because they are so similar, the terms ‘mule’ and ‘hinny’ are used interchangeably, with hinnies often being referred to as mules. KEY FACTS ABOUT MULES AND HINNIES: Mule: The result of a donkey stallion mating with a female horse. Mules tend to have the head of a donkey and extremities of a horse. Hinny: The result of a horse stallion mating with a female donkey. Hinnies are less common than mules and there might be subtle differences in appearance. Size: Varies greatly depending on the stallion and mare. Ranging from 91-172 cm. Health: Hardy and tough. They often have good immune systems. Strength: Extremely strong. They pull heavy loads and carry much heavier weights than donkeys or horses of a similar size. Behaviour: Intelligent and sensitive. They can have unpredictable reactions. Appearance: Ears smaller than a donkey’s, the same shape as a horse’s. The mane and tail of a hinny is usually similar to a horse. Vocalisation: A mixture of a donkey’s ‘bray’ and a horse’s ‘whinny’. Sex: Male is a ‘horse mule’ (also known as a ‘john’ or ‘jack’). Female is a ‘mare mule’ (also known as a ‘molly’). Young: A ‘colt’ (male) or ‘filly’ (female). What is hybrid vigour? Hybrid = a crossbreed Vigour = hardiness or resilience • ‘Interbreeding’ (crossbreeding) can remove weaker characteristics and instead pass on desirable inherited traits. This is ‘hybrid vigour’, a term often associated with mules and hinnies. -

The effect on performance in sports in descendents of CLCN1 gene mutation carrier New Forest pony stallions Authors: D.M. Dickhoff; I.D. Wijnberg Abstract Aim of the study: To determine if ponies descending from a CLCN1 gene mutation carrier stallion perform better in sports, compared to ponies that do not descent from a CLCN1 gene mutation carrier stallion. Study design: Data analysis of 11.414 New Forest ponies, in which the relationship between the descent of the ponies and their sport performance are analyzed. Methods: Ponies were divided in jumping, dressage and eventing categories. They were listed categorically from the lowest category to the highest and descendents from mutation carrier stallions were marked. Statistical analysis with logistic regression between the sport categories and within the categories has been performed using SPSS version 19. Significance was set at p < 0.05. Results: Ponies descending from a mutation carrying stallion are significantly better performing in jumping. The odds of finding a descent in the highest jumping category is 7.6 compared to the lowest. In dressage, descendents from a gene mutation carrier stallion are performing significantly better, with an odds of 4.1 for performing in the highest category. In eventing, the odds of finding a descendent from a mutation carrying stallion in the highest category is 2.9 compared to the lowest. Conclusion and clinical relevance: Ponies that are descendants of a mutation carrying stallion are performing significantly better in jumping, dressage and eventing. This conclusion might lead to breeding programs which includes stallions who carry this mutation, aiming to breed better performing ponies in equine sports, which is in contrast of the aim of the Studbook to eradicate the mutation. -

1 Nature of Horse Breeds The horse captures our imagination because of its beauty, power and, most of all, its personality. Today, we encounter a wide array of horse breeds, developed for diverse purposes. Much of this diversity did not exist at the time of domestication of the horse, 5500 years ago (Chapter 2). Modern breeds were developed through genetic selection and based on the variety of uses of horses during the advance of civilization. Domestication of the horse revolutionized civilization. A rider could go farther and faster than people had ever gone before. Horses provided power to till more land and move heavier loads. Any sort of horse could provide these benefits, as long as it could be domesticated. However, over time people became more discern- ing about the characteristics of their horses. The intuitive and genetic principle that “like begat like” led people to choose the best horses as breeding stock. At the same time, people in different parts of the world used different criteria when select- ing horses. The horses were raised in different climates, fed different rations, exposed to different infectious diseases, and asked to do different types of work. Genetic differences could and did have a large impact on these traits. Over time, selection led to the creation of diverse types of horse around the world. We use a variety of terms to describe the genetic diversity among groups of animals, both to distinguish horses from other animals and examine differences among the different types of horses. Those terms include genus, species, popula- tion, landrace, and breed. -

New Forest Pony Breeding and Cattle Society 2020 Autumn Stallion Inspection As with most 2020 events, the planned April inspection had to be cancelled, but with Covid-19 restrictions easing into the autumn, all owners on the April list were invited to what was necessarily a ‘behind closed doors’ inspection held with strict adherence to the government’s current Covid-19 regulations. With most owners taking up the offer, it was a busy morning, on a lovely sunny day. The top colt, by a good margin, was Mallards Wood Saint John, bred by Robert Maton. It was most pleasing that two colts who had come through the Futurity Scheme, Limekiln Shamrock and Mogshade Quarryman, made the top five, with Shamrock being the top Forest-bred colt. All the approved colts must now complete the vetting and DNA and PSSM1 testing procedures before they are fully licensed.
